Etymology

From a place name in Aberdeenshire, from Scottish Gaelic lios cuileann ("garden of hollies").

Origin: Scottish Gaelic

What is the difference between Leslie and Lesley?

They are two spellings of the same name, often split by gender in British usage, where "Leslie" tends to be the male spelling and "Lesley" the female one. In American usage this distinction is weaker, and Leslie is commonly given to girls.

Is Leslie a boy's or a girl's name?

Leslie is unisex. Historically it was a male given name and a Scottish surname, but over the 20th century it became widely used for girls as well, especially in North America.

Is Leslie a first name or a surname?

Leslie is both. It began as a Scottish surname, itself linked to place names in Scotland, and later came into use as a given name for both men and women.
